Series Analysis:
Gingerbread Land: The Biggest Little Holiday Competition proves that holiday baking is less about gumdrops and more about high-stakes structural engineering. The debut season challenged expert bakers to defy gravity, transforming simple dough into immersive worlds where a single crack in the foundation could topple an entire festive village.
